A SMALL BRONZE RITUAL WINE VESSEL, ZHI
LATE SHANG/EARLY WESTERN ZHOU DYNASTY, 11TH CENTURY BC
Of rounded oval section, the deep body raised on a spreading pedestal foot encircled by a bow-string band, the sides cast in relief on both sides with a taotie mask between single and double bow-string borders, with milky green patina
5¼ in. (13.3 cm.) high, lucite stand
Provenance
Acquired in Hong Kong, 14 May 1999.
